A106012 Primes p such that 70*p - 3 and 70*p + 3 are both primes. 1
5, 17, 23, 59, 71, 73, 83, 103, 127, 149, 157, 173, 307, 311, 331, 373, 419, 433, 467, 521, 593, 643, 709, 797, 811, 839, 859, 881, 907, 919, 929, 1019, 1031, 1033, 1039, 1171, 1249, 1277, 1279, 1297, 1361, 1447, 1543, 1579, 1583, 1669, 1709, 1847, 1867 (list; graph; refs; listen; history; text; internal format)

MATHEMATICA
Select[Prime[Range[400]], PrimeQ[70#+3]&&PrimeQ[70#-3]&]
PROG
(Magma) [p: p in PrimesUpTo(5000)|IsPrime(70*p+3) and IsPrime(70*p-3)] // Vincenzo Librandi, Jan 30 2011
